diff --git a/protocol/app/testdata/default_genesis_state.json b/protocol/app/testdata/default_genesis_state.json index 59694209d7..4a521b1e5c 100644 --- a/protocol/app/testdata/default_genesis_state.json +++ b/protocol/app/testdata/default_genesis_state.json @@ -385,12 +385,12 @@ "denom": "ibc/8E27BA2D5493AF5636760E354E46004562C46AB7EC0CC4C1CA14E9E20E2545B5", "limiters": [ { - "baseline_minimum": "100000000000", + "baseline_minimum": "1000000000000", "baseline_tvl_ppm": 10000, "period": "3600s" }, { - "baseline_minimum": "1000000000000", + "baseline_minimum": "10000000000000", "baseline_tvl_ppm": 100000, "period": "86400s" } diff --git a/protocol/scripts/genesis/sample_pregenesis.json b/protocol/scripts/genesis/sample_pregenesis.json index 2a149e674f..58f7b7d594 100644 --- a/protocol/scripts/genesis/sample_pregenesis.json +++ b/protocol/scripts/genesis/sample_pregenesis.json @@ -1694,12 +1694,12 @@ "denom": "ibc/8E27BA2D5493AF5636760E354E46004562C46AB7EC0CC4C1CA14E9E20E2545B5", "limiters": [ { - "baseline_minimum": "100000000000", + "baseline_minimum": "1000000000000", "baseline_tvl_ppm": 10000, "period": "3600s" }, { - "baseline_minimum": "1000000000000", + "baseline_minimum": "10000000000000", "baseline_tvl_ppm": 100000, "period": "86400s" } @@ -1782,7 +1782,7 @@ ] } }, - "app_version": "3.0.0-dev0-60-ge0fd2767", + "app_version": "4.0.0-dev0-22-gd31fa077", "chain_id": "dydx-sample-1", "consensus": { "params": { diff --git a/protocol/testutil/constants/genesis.go b/protocol/testutil/constants/genesis.go index 459390c7ed..0dc9e7ab96 100644 --- a/protocol/testutil/constants/genesis.go +++ b/protocol/testutil/constants/genesis.go @@ -1366,12 +1366,12 @@ const GenesisState = `{ "denom": "ibc/8E27BA2D5493AF5636760E354E46004562C46AB7EC0CC4C1CA14E9E20E2545B5", "limiters": [ { - "baseline_minimum": "100000000000", + "baseline_minimum": "1000000000000", "baseline_tvl_ppm": 10000, "period": "3600s" }, { - "baseline_minimum": "1000000000000", + "baseline_minimum": "10000000000000", "baseline_tvl_ppm": 100000, "period": "86400s" } diff --git a/protocol/x/ratelimit/types/params.go b/protocol/x/ratelimit/types/params.go index c500613bf0..4d3917a96f 100644 --- a/protocol/x/ratelimit/types/params.go +++ b/protocol/x/ratelimit/types/params.go @@ -13,13 +13,13 @@ import ( // BigBaselineMinimum1Hr defines the minimum baseline USDC for the 1-hour rate-limit. var BigBaselineMinimum1Hr = new(big.Int).Mul( - big.NewInt(100_000), // 100k full coins + big.NewInt(1_000_000), // 1m full coins lib.BigPow10(-assettypes.UusdcDenomExponent), ) // BigBaselineMinimum1Day defines the minimum baseline USDC for the 1-day rate-limit. var BigBaselineMinimum1Day = new(big.Int).Mul( - big.NewInt(1_000_000), // 1m full coins + big.NewInt(10_000_000), // 10m full coins lib.BigPow10(-assettypes.UusdcDenomExponent), ) diff --git a/protocol/x/ratelimit/types/params_test.go b/protocol/x/ratelimit/types/params_test.go index f2fbffde1a..70af317888 100644 --- a/protocol/x/ratelimit/types/params_test.go +++ b/protocol/x/ratelimit/types/params_test.go @@ -16,12 +16,12 @@ func TestDefaultUsdcRateLimitParams(t *testing.T) { Limiters: []types.Limiter{ { Period: 3600 * time.Second, - BaselineMinimum: dtypes.NewInt(100_000_000_000), + BaselineMinimum: dtypes.NewInt(1_000_000_000_000), BaselineTvlPpm: 10_000, }, { Period: 24 * time.Hour, - BaselineMinimum: dtypes.NewInt(1_000_000_000_000), + BaselineMinimum: dtypes.NewInt(10_000_000_000_000), BaselineTvlPpm: 100_000, }, },